“Tragic Crash: 8 Dead in B-52 Bomber Accident”

At least eight individuals lost their lives following the crash of a bomber aircraft at a significant US Air Force base in California. The incident led to a massive plume of smoke visible over the base, signaling the aircraft’s descent.

Reports from Edwards Air Force Base confirmed that a United States Air Force B-52 Stratofortress crashed shortly after takeoff at 11:20 am. Hours later, authorities announced the tragic loss of eight lives in the accident.

A statement from the base disclosed that a B-52 Stratofortress carrying eight personnel on a routine test mission crashed soon after departing at 11:20 a.m., with initial assessments suggesting the crash was unsurvivable. Emergency response teams were deployed, and efforts were underway to verify the status of all personnel involved.

Images capturing smoke rising from the base located in the Mojave Desert in Southern California circulated online, prompting inquiries from concerned individuals. The base, known for hosting test flights by the Air Force and NASA for new and experimental aircraft, spans over 300,000 acres in Kern County, with extensions into San Bernardino and Los Angeles counties.

Following the incident, a spokesperson for the base announced the closure of the airfield and diversion of inbound aircraft. Visitor access was restricted to prioritize emergency response operations.

The B-52 Stratofortress, a long-range bomber in service since the 1950s, remains a vital asset in the US military’s aerial capabilities. Capable of carrying conventional and nuclear armaments over extensive distances, the aircraft has seen action in various conflicts, including the Vietnam War and recent military engagements.

Edwards Air Force Base, located in California, functions as the Air Force Flight Test Center and plays a crucial role in aerospace systems research, development, and evaluation from concept to combat deployment.
